Foster Care Tax Credit

The Arizona Foster Care Tax Credit allows taxpayers to receive a dollar-for-dollar reduction in their state income tax liability by donating to qualifying foster care charitable organizations. For the 2025 tax year, the maximum credit amounts are:
 
  • Single filers: Up to $618
  • Married couples filing jointly: Up to $1,234

These contributions support organizations that provide immediate basic needs to children in foster care.

To claim this credit, you must:
 
  1. Make a Qualifying Donation: Donate to a certified Qualifying Foster Care Charitable Organization (QFCO) before April 15, 2026, to apply the credit to your 2025 tax return.

  2. Obtain a Receipt: Ensure you receive a receipt from the organization confirming your donation.

  3. Complete Form 352: When filing your Arizona state tax return, include Form 352, "Credit for Contributions to Qualifying Foster Care Charitable Organizations," and provide the organization's QFCO code: 10022
